. Electric railway journal . THE ELLCON COMPANY 50 Church Street, New York Its all in this spring. Better commutation and reducedmotor flashing is made possible in LindallBrush Holders through the constant, uniform contact pressureof these phosphor-bronze springs. They have no turns to bind and stick as isthe case with coil springs. Another big feature of Lindall Holders is the large and efficient contact surface theyafford between brush and holder, which elim-inates the necessity of troublesome pigtails—any brush will fit a Lindall—no preparationof cutting or filing is needed.
